Exhibition of Shingo Honda work evokes changing realities

Courtesy photo “Parallel #15,” acrylic/graphite on canvas created in 2001, is one of the works on view at the East Hawaii Cultural Center.

“I don’t know any of the people in these paintings, and they don’t know each other,” said the late artist Shingo Honda, who lived almost a decade-and-a-half on the Big Island, about the works he produced between 2000 and 2004 in downtown Los Angeles.
